@import url(https://fonts.googleapis.com/css2?family=Aleo:ital,wght@0,100..900;1,100..900&display=swap);@font-face{font-family:Aleo;src:url(../fonts/Aleo-Regular.ttf) format("truetype");font-weight:400;font-style:normal}@font-face{font-family:Aleo;src:url(../fonts/Aleo-Bold.ttf) format("truetype");font-weight:700;font-style:normal}@font-face{font-family:"PT Sans";src:url(../fonts/PTSans-Regular.ttf) format("truetype");font-weight:400;font-style:normal}@font-face{font-family:"PT Sans";src:url(../fonts/PTSans-Bold.ttf) format("truetype");font-weight:700;font-style:normal}@font-face{font-family:"Fira Sans";src:url(../fonts/FiraSans-Regular.ttf) format("truetype");font-weight:400;font-style:normal}@font-face{font-family:"Fira Sans";src:url(../fonts/FiraSans-Bold.ttf) format("truetype");font-weight:700;font-style:normal}@font-face{font-family:"Font Awesome 6 Sharp";font-style:normal;font-weight:300;font-display:block;src:url(../fonts/fa-sharp-light-300.woff2) format("woff2"),url(../fonts/fa-sharp-light-300.ttf) format("truetype")}.work-landing-page{width:1440px;align-content:center;margin:0 auto}.work-landing-page .work-page-contents-header{max-width:1152px;margin:24px auto;display:flex;flex-direction:column}.work-landing-page .work-page-contents-header .breadcrumb-container{padding-bottom:24px}.work-landing-page .work-page-contents-header .work-page-header{display:flex;flex-direction:column;padding-bottom:48px}.work-landing-page .work-page-contents-header .work-page-header .work-page-header-image{width:100%;height:420px;object-fit:cover}.work-landing-page .work-page-contents-header .work-page-header .work-page-header-title{font-family:Aleo;font-size:39px;font-weight:800;line-height:58.5px;color:#1e2e5e;margin-bottom:0}.work-landing-page .work-page-contents-header .work-page-header .work-page-header-details{font-family:"PT Sans";font-size:16px;font-weight:400;line-height:24px;color:#222;margin-top:0}.work-landing-page .work-page-contents{max-width:1440px;margin:24px auto;display:flex;flex-direction:column;gap:48px}.work-landing-page .work-page-search-careers-container{width:100%;height:367px;background-color:#012a60}.work-landing-page .work-page-search-careers-container .work-page-search-careers{display:flex;max-width:1440px;margin:24px auto;justify-content:center;align-items:center;height:100%}.work-landing-page .work-page-search-careers-container .work-page-search-careers span{color:#fff;font-size:64px}.work-landing-page .job-market-trend-search-careers-container{background-color:#012a60}.work-landing-page .job-market-trend-search-careers-container .job-market-trend-search-careers{max-width:1152px;margin:0 auto}.work-landing-page .job-market-trend-search-careers-container .job-market-trend-search-careers #search-form-container{padding:0}.work-landing-page .job-market-trend-search-careers-container .job-market-trend-search-careers #search-form-container .search-container{padding:2rem 0}.work-landing-page .job-market-trend-search-careers-container #search-results{display:none}.work-landing-page .work-page-find-career{width:100%;background-color:#31595f}@media screen and (max-width:1024px){.work-landing-page{width:100%}.work-landing-page .work-page-contents-header{max-width:976px;margin:16px}.work-landing-page .job-market-trend-search-careers{max-width:976px!important}.work-landing-page .work-page-market-trends{max-width:976px}.work-landing-page .work-page-find-career{max-width:976px!important}.work-landing-page .work-page-career-resource{max-width:976px}.work-landing-page .work-page-career-groups{max-width:976px}}@media screen and (max-width:768px){.work-landing-page{width:100%;overflow-x:hidden}.work-landing-page .work-page-contents-header{padding:16px;width:100%;margin:0}.work-landing-page .work-page-contents-header .breadcrumb-container{padding-bottom:16px;font-size:14px}.work-landing-page .work-page-contents-header .work-page-header{width:100%;padding-bottom:24px}.work-landing-page .work-page-contents-header .work-page-header .work-page-header-image{height:240px;margin:0 -16px;width:calc(100% + 32px)}.work-landing-page .work-page-contents-header .work-page-header .work-page-header-title{font-size:28px;font-weight:700;line-height:36px;margin-top:16px}.work-landing-page .work-page-contents-header .work-page-header .work-page-header-details{font-size:14px;line-height:20px;margin-top:8px}.work-landing-page .work-page-contents{gap:24px;margin:0}.work-landing-page .work-page-search-careers-container{height:auto;min-height:200px}.work-landing-page .work-page-search-careers-container .work-page-search-careers{padding:40px 16px;margin:0}.work-landing-page .work-page-search-careers-container .work-page-search-careers span{font-size:32px;line-height:40px;text-align:center}.work-landing-page .job-market-trend-search-careers-container .job-market-trend-search-careers{padding:0 16px!important}.work-landing-page .job-market-trend-search-careers-container .job-market-trend-search-careers #search-form-container .search-container{padding:1.5rem 0}}
